Veuve Clicquot Vintage Tasting Cave Privée

Rotterdam, Netherlands

Tasted May 14, 2017 by Barry Rothof with 422 views

Flight 1 (1 note)

White - Sparkling
2006 Veuve Clicquot Champagne Brut La Grande Dame France, Champagne
93 points
Refreshing on the nose and palate with delicious apple, floral notes and a little chalk, balanced with strong mouthwatering acidity and enormous potential.

Flight 2 (1 note)

White - Sparkling
1989 Veuve Clicquot Champagne Vintage Cave Privée France, Champagne
94 points
Gold color with amber reflections. Amazing nose with a combination of sweetness, yeastiness and earth. On the palate full, round and supple with dried flowers and candied citrus fruit. Very rich and ready now.

Flight 3 (1 note)

White - Sparkling
1982 Veuve Clicquot Champagne Vintage Cave Privée France, Champagne
96 points
In contrast to the 1989, this wine had stronger acidity, with mature vanilla spice, a little bread and enormous complexity but still crisp and refreshing with few and small bubbles. This rare and stunning wine is far from its peak.

Flight 4 (1 note)

Rosé - Sparkling
2004 Veuve Clicquot Champagne Brut Rosé Vintage France, Champagne
92 points
Showing small, subtle bubbles and a pale salmon color. Floral notes in great balance with the bubbles and mouthwatering acidity.

Flight 5 (1 note)

Rosé - Sparkling
2006 Veuve Clicquot Champagne Brut Rosé La Grande Dame France, Champagne
93 points
Pale salmon color. On the nose and palate lovely apricot and refined acidity. Elegant, mineral and refreshing with enormous potential.

Flight 6 (1 note)

Rosé - Sparkling
1990 Veuve Clicquot Champagne Vintage Rosé Cave Privée France, Champagne
95 points
Beautiful salmon color with copper tints. Precise red pinot fruit and bread flavors combined with chalk and crisp acidity with smooth, soft discrete bubbles. This wine is still reserved and will show more complexity with time.
